Data Entry

Data entry involves inputting information into a computerized system. This can include tasks such as entering data into spreadsheets, databases, or other software applications. While the work may seem straightforward, it plays a crucial role in maintaining organized and up-to-date records for businesses and organizations.

One of the primary advantages of online data entry is its flexibility. Most data entry tasks can be completed remotely, allowing you to work from the comfort of your home. This flexibility is especially beneficial for those looking to supplement their income or balance work with other commitments.

Unlike some online gigs that may require specific technical skills, data entry typically doesn’t demand a specialized skill set. Basic computer skills, attention to detail, and a good typing speed are often sufficient to get started.

While the pay might start at $10 per hour, as you gain experience and demonstrate reliability, you may find opportunities with higher hourly rates. Additionally, many data entry tasks are ongoing, providing a reliable stream of income for those who consistently deliver quality work.

Websites like Upwork, Freelancer, and Fiverr are excellent platforms for finding data entry jobs. Create a profile, showcase your skills, and start bidding on relevant projects. Over time, positive reviews and completed projects will help you secure higher-paying opportunities.

Job boards like Indeed and Glassdoor often list remote data entry positions. Regularly check these platforms for new opportunities and tailor your application to highlight your relevant skills and experience.

Explore websites specifically dedicated to data entry jobs, such as Clickworker, DionData Solutions, or Amazon’s Mechanical Turk. These platforms connect businesses with freelancers for various data-related tasks.

Online job boards are excellent resources for finding a variety of employment opportunities, including online data entry positions. These platforms aggregate job listings from various sources, making it easier for individuals to explore different opportunities. If you’re looking to make $10 per hour or more through online data entry, consider exploring the following online job boards:

1. Indeed: Indeed is one of the largest and most widely used job search engines. It features a vast array of job listings, including remote and online data entry positions. You can filter your search based on location, job type, and salary to find opportunities that match your criteria.

2. Glassdoor: Glassdoor not only provides job listings but also offers company reviews and salary information. This can be valuable when researching potential employers. You can use Glassdoor to search for remote data entry positions and gain insights into the companies you’re interested in.

3. LinkedIn: LinkedIn is a professional networking platform that also features a job board. Many companies post job openings on LinkedIn, and you can set up job alerts to receive notifications about new data entry opportunities that match your preferences.

4. Monster: Monster is a comprehensive job board that covers a wide range of industries and job types. You can search for remote or online data entry positions and customize your job alerts to receive relevant updates.

5. SimplyHired: SimplyHired is a job search engine that aggregates job listings from various sources, including company websites and job boards. It’s a convenient platform to explore data entry jobs and filter results based on location and salary.

6. Remote OK: Remote OK is a job board specifically dedicated to remote work opportunities. It features a variety of remote positions, including data entry roles. You can search for jobs, view salary information, and apply directly through the platform.

7. FlexJobs: FlexJobs is a subscription-based job board that focuses on remote and flexible job opportunities. While there is a fee to access the full listings, FlexJobs carefully curates its job postings, making it a valuable resource for finding legitimate remote data entry positions.

If you’re looking for specialized data entry websites that cater specifically to data-related tasks, there are platforms designed to connect freelancers with businesses seeking assistance in managing and processing their data. These websites offer a focused approach, making it easier to find data entry opportunities. Here are some specialized data entry websites to explore:

1. Clickworker: Clickworker is a platform that connects individuals with micro-tasking projects, including data entry. You can sign up as a Clickworker and access various tasks, such as data categorization, text creation, and data tagging. The platform is known for its straightforward process and diverse opportunities.

2. DionData Solutions: DionData Solutions specializes in data entry services and often hires independent contractors to work on projects. They may require you to take an assessment to evaluate your skills before being considered for available opportunities.

3. Amazon Mechanical Turk: Amazon Mechanical Turk (MTurk) is a crowdsourcing marketplace that allows businesses to post microtasks, including data entry tasks. You can browse available HITs (Human Intelligence Tasks) and select those that align with your skills and interests.

4. SmartCrowd (formerly VirtualBee): SmartCrowd is a platform that offers data entry tasks to freelancers. It involves tasks such as data categorization, data tagging, and data enhancement. The platform provides flexibility in terms of when and how much you work.

5. SigTrack: SigTrack specializes in signature and voter registration data entry tasks. The platform often hires remote workers for seasonal projects related to elections and voter registration. Accuracy is crucial for tasks on SigTrack.

6. Axion Data Entry Services: Axion Data Entry Services is a company that occasionally hires independent contractors for data entry projects. They may require a background check, and they prefer candidates with prior data entry experience.

7. TDEC (The Data Entry Company): TDEC is a company that provides outsourcing solutions for data entry services. They may have remote opportunities for data entry professionals, and you can explore their website for potential job openings.
